Output 58ac5de7deee4d8fd9b7670d3c4496dd67600cec7b3d0905e2da9c7acfa2bd1f:1

value
6000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 da839c97bc7f2096a22668dbaaef168caec6ba13 OP_EQUAL
address
3McQtuM6fqzP74jrfF64ibtkSj7sgzhFwP
transaction
58ac5de7deee4d8fd9b7670d3c4496dd67600cec7b3d0905e2da9c7acfa2bd1f
confirmations
382893
spent
true